[QUOTE="Riley, post: 3174185, member: 29196"] Some drone footage of the devastation in Paradise. For those just joining it was a town of some 30,000 residents. [MEDIA=youtube]f5X3SgecIns[/MEDIA] A cut and paste from a twit feed - If you twit, the writer, Toussaint seems to be one of the best informed and active. He is posting regular, accurate updates of the situation and developments. The area is not forecast to receive rain til mid week and the Santa Anna's continue. - 63 fatalities, 53 identified, 631 missing - 11,862 structures destroyed (residential/commercial combined) 270 damaged, 9700 single family homes included in that total. - 141,000+ acres burned - 40% containment - Possible 2nd origin of the fire Dave Toussaint (@engineco16) [URL='https://twitter.com/engineco16/status/1063257857456390144?ref_src=twsrc%5Etfw']November 16, 2018[/URL] [/QUOTE]
